What are the benefits of whey protein for muscle recovery?
It provides essential amino acids that repair muscle fibers after exercise. This helps reduce soreness and build strength over time. For women in fitness, it supports lean mass without bulk, and it combats age-related muscle loss effectively.

Is whey protein good for digestive health?
Yes, isolates are low in lactose, reducing bloating. Added fibers like pectin promote gut balance. It's gentle for most, helping nutrient absorption. My Health Buddy highlights its immune support too.
